Question 48948: Eric bikes 12 mph with no wind. Against the wind she bikes 8 miles in the same time that it takes to bike 14miles with the wind. Find the speed of the wind.

speed with no wind=12 mph
wind speed =w
speed against wind =12-w mph
speed with wind=12+w mph
time=t
distance against wind =t(12-w)=8.......................1
distance with wind=t(w+12)=14...................2
eqn.2/eqn.1=(w+12)/(12-w)=14/8=7/4
4(w+12)=7(12-w)
4w+48=84-7w
7w+4w=84-48=36
11w=36
w=36/11=3.27 mph
